I bought the heritage last October, bought the stock rims this spring and had them painted. The race graphics duplicate chassis P-1075 the Lemans winning car. They are static cling. I love the look of this car....stunning if I do say so myself. There are a few pics of it the GT book by Joey with the roundels on prior to number application.

It appears that you emulated the 1969 version (No. 6). as the graphics on P/1075 were different each year along with the number? 1968 graphics correspond to No. 9.
 
Last edited:
That is correct. Same chassis number two years in a row. Number 6 in 1969 driven by Jacky Ickyx and Jackie Oliver.
